On our first day in Suffolk we rented a car and meandered from Stansted Airport to the house of my dear friend Nicky. On our way – crossing Saffron Walden – we saw this fantastic fairy tale chateau and stopped to visit it.
It is called Audley End House and it is totally worth a visit. The staff is incredibly professional and passionate which met greatly with our curiosity.
